How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Robertson?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Robertson Studio Apartments | $1,784 | $1,385 | $2,380 |
| Robertson 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,971 | $1,250 | $2,536 |
| Robertson 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,413 | $1,450 | $3,170 |
| Robertson 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,757 | $2,576 | $2,893 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Robertson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Robertson with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Robertson is at 208-210 Main listed at $1,385.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Robertson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Robertson is $1,784.
What is the largest available Studio Robertson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Robertson is a 450 square feet unit starting from $1,385 at 208-210 Main.
What is the average size for Robertson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Robertson is currently 475 sq ft.
